Objective ― to present a brief literature review and a clinical case of asymptomatic course of parvovirus B19 infection in a pregnant woman with intrauterine fetal damage.
Material and methods. Literary sources were studied, medical documents were analyzed (ambulatory observation cards and medical histories of in-patients).
Results. A brief literature review on parvovirus infection is presented. Peculiarities of the clinical course of parvovirus infection in adults are investigated. A clinical case of asymptomatic course of parvovirus infection in a pregnant woman with intrauterine fetal damage is presented (development of non-immune hydrops).
Conclusion. The main clinical manifestations of the disease in adults are not specific and this disease is difficult to diagnose. As transplacental transmission from mother to fetus with the development of non-immune fetal hydrops is possible, even under asymptomatic course, it is necessary to raise awareness among doctors about the possible consequences of this infection, and to examine pregnant women who contacted parvovirus B19 infection patients for the early etiological diagnosis of the pathological process.
Key words: parvovirus B19, rash, pregnancy, non-immune hydrops of the fetus.
